Abstract
An enclosure for a computing device adapted to resist ingress of environmental elements comprises a frame, a first cover attached and sealed to the frame, and a second cover attached and sealed to the frame. The frame provides a sidewall structure including a first pair of channels having a first length and a second pair of channels having a second length. Each channel is separately fabricated and the frame is formed by corners of the first pair of channels to corners of the second pair of channels.

10. A computing device, comprising:
- an enclosure adapted to resist ingress of environmental elements, the enclosure including a frame, a front cover attached and sealed to the frame and a back cover attached and sealed to the frame;
wherein the frame includes a first pair of channels having a first length and defining opposite sides of the frame, wherein each channel from the first pair of channels includes a frame sidewall partially defining an inner space of the enclosure, and a front lip and a back lip each extending outward substantially the same distance and substantially parallel to each other so that the frame sidewall is recessed relative to an outer edge of the frame, and a second pair of channels having a second length and defining opposite ends of the frame, wherein each channel from the second pair of channels includes a frame sidewall partially defining an inner space of the enclosure, and a front lip and a back lip each extending outward substantially the same distance and substantially parallel to each other so that the frame sidewall is recessed relative to an outer edge of the frame, wherein a distance between the front lip and the back lip is substantially the same for each of the channels and substantially defines a thickness of the enclosure;
wherein the back cover is attached to the frame via a plurality of attachments points formed in the back lip for each channel of the first and second pairs of channels; and
wherein the front cover attached to the frame via a plurality of attachments points formed in corners defined by the front lips of the frame;
one or more circuit boards positioned within a tray;
wherein the tray is mounted to the back cover via a plurality of grommets such that the tray is arranged between and spaced apart from the front cover and back cover;
a display mounted to the front cover, wherein the display is sealed along edge of the display to the front cover to resist ingress;
one or more modules for housing a component adapted to communicate with the one or more circuit boards to provide functionality to the computing device, wherein a width of the one or more modules is approximately the thickness of the enclosure, and wherein the one or more modules is seatable within a channel from the first and second pairs of channels and against the frame sidewall of the channel outside of the enclosure such that at least a portion of the one or more modules is recessed relative to the outer edge of the frame. - View Dependent Claims (11, 12, 13, 14, 15)
